Born in 1983 in Bernay and graduated from the Ecole des Beaux-Arts in Rouen in 2006, the young Guillaume Viaud was particularly noted in 2009 at the 54th Salon de Montrouge. He exhibited "Walking Piece", a cube covered with mirrors and equipped with straps to be carried on the back and the wall, a set of eight photographic prints in color. These photographs, taken by someone else, show the artist with its cube-mirror back that travels the famous garden of Claude Monet in Giverny, among the flower beds. This series of photographs documenting the artist's walk from different points of view. The variety of frames can show the carrier back, or three-quarters in the foreground of the image, or disseminated in vegetation among the tourists, among other silhouette. The visible faces of the mirror multiply the plant environment to suggest a phenomenon of visual pop. Thus, while the artist is just background, it is distinguished from the environment as a reflection of her bright and square-cube mirror that becomes a kind of blinding signal.
While he revisits this high place of inspiration for Claude Monet became a tourist site, Viaud us into games fresh perspective. His backpack is a rudimentary tool that multiplies the points of view and, in turn, gives us to see other approaches to real can not be reduced to a single photograph, but here at eight, the selection valid for all Other potential.
The young artist explores the limits of the world and its representation. The series of tape measures articulated demonstrates, in the form of relief, his interest in the relativity of the measure presented here as a broken line, as a remembrance of accident Stoppages-Stallions of Marcel Duchamp.

Temptation of Ukiyo brand relationship that can sustain a Western gaze with Japanese culture and society.

is the desire to capture the Ukiyo, capture a representation of this "floating world", evanescent and fleeting as it is designated with the term Ukiyo. It is also more modest wish of being one with his environment, away from all ideas of the exotic, to approach the world by focusing on its details, its peripheries.

Francois Cavelier has hired a photographic essay on Japan since 2008. He is interested in cultural phenomena such as gastronomy, Fujisan to grasp the social dimensions that are the relations of individuals to their environment, the organization of life in society.

His work is part of the culture of American photographers such as Stephen Shore and William Eggleston in particular their ability to grasp the real one era and culture by tapping into the roots of everyday life but also making space for each photograph a full subjects.

Since his disappearance, Piotr Kowalski (1927-2004), one of the most important artists and the most singular of the second half of the 20th century, was "Lost", at least by the institutions of modern and contemporary art which he has nevertheless often been exposed. At the initiative of Karaïndros Jason, who was part of the workshop that the sculptor has led to the Ecole Nationale Superieure des Beaux-Arts in Paris, the Ecole des Beaux-Arts de Rouen organizes an exhibition that wants to be first not in the way of recognition necessary. At the outset, the idea was to combine the presentation of some key works of the artist to that of today's young artists working in the same field of imagination, the approaches where attention to this which is released for thought in the sciences of nature plays a predominant role.

United by Jason Karaïndros, multimedia artist and professor at the School of Rouen and Jean-Christophe Bailly, author of a monograph and numerous texts on Kowalski, four young artists, therefore, agreed give substance to their work by this idea of continuity speculative contemporary art. Two of them, Jiro Nakayama and Jun Takita, were students and assistants Piotr Kowalski, whose ties with Japan were very close. The other two, younger (Bettina Samson and Rodolphe Delaunay), have not known. But what is at stake, they are certainly not influence, let alone a family, a certain community is attitude, and the decision to radically modern.
